publicPath: 网站运行时的访问路径 filename: 打包后的文件名 现在来看如何打包一个React组件。假设有如下项目文件夹结构: - react-demo+ assets/ - js/Hello.js entry.js index.html webpack.config.js 其中Hello.js定义了一个简单的React组件,使用ES6语法: varReact = require('react');classHello extends Re...
//生成默认package.josn 文件npm init//安装 webpack 和 webpack-dev-servernpm install webpack webpack-dev-server --save-dev//安装 react react-domnpm install react react-dom --save//安装 babel-core 、babel-loader、babel-preset-env、babel-preset-reactnpm install babel-core babel-loader babel-p...
react webpack.config.js配置文件 标签: Html/CSS 收藏 module.exports={ devtool:'eval-source-map', /__dirname 获取nodejs的详细路径/ /入口文件/ entry:dirname+'/app/app.js', /输出文件/ output:{ /输出路径/ path:dirname+'/build', /输出文件名/ filename:'bundle.js' }, module: { /es6...
I'm using the react library and building using webpack. When I try building a base64 version of a pdf using pdfmake within my react app I get the following error: Uncaught File 'Roboto-Regular.ttf' not found in virtual file system I've r...
webpack 运行的时候回自动找到项目根目录的 webpack.config.js 文件,所以我们可以先创建这个文件,并加入如下代码。 const path = require('path') module.exports = { entry: { main: './src/index.js' }, output: { filename: '[name].[hash].js', ...
webpack.config.js文件内容 核心的webpack的配置内容 L136 return mode根据isEnvProduction判断当前环境,webpackEnv bail一旦在打包过程中遇到错误就及时停止,不再往下打包了,直接报错,(开发环境继续打包,线上环境停止打包) devtool shouldUseSourceMap根据在全局变量中是否配置了GENERATE_SOURCEMAP ...
// webpack.common.ts`import{Configuration}from'webpack';import{projectName,projectRoot,resolvePath}from'../env';constcommonConfig:Configuration={context:projectRoot,entry:resolvePath(projectRoot,'./src/index.tsx'),output:{publicPath:'/',path:resolvePath(projectRoot,'./dist'),filename:'js/[name...
4.根目录创建webpack.config.js文件,代码如下 const path = require('path'); const HtmlWebPackPlugin = require('html-webpack-plugin'); const htmlPlugin = new HtmlWebPackPlugin({ template: './public/index.html', filename: './index.html', }); module.exports = { entry: './src/index.ts...
创建webpack的配制文件webpack.config.js module.exports={ mode:'development',// production development }; 1. 2. 3. 目前项目目录如下: 然后在命令行中执行 webpack 打包项目 打包完成后,在dist 目录下就生成了打包后的 main.js 文件 然后配制 webpack-dev-server ...
创建webpack的配制文件webpack.config.js module.exports = { mode: 'development',// production development }; 1. 2. 3. 目前项目目录如下: 然后在命令行中执行 webpack 打包项目 打包完成后,在dist 目录下就生成了打包后的 main.js 文件 然后配制 webpack-dev-server ...